WebDec 21, 2024 · Mourning doves do not lay eggs only once a year. They are known to raise as many as six broods each year. Interestingly, they do so in a new nest every time. Female mourning doves normally lay two eggs per brood. Since the nests are clumsily made, the eggs or young tend to fall out. So, doves try laying eggs repeatedly to raise enough babies.
